Share what you are doing for your different workloads in your environments (Nutanix or otherwise). -- To optimize storage capacity and accelerate application performance, the Acropolis Distributed Storage Fabric uses data efficiency techniques such as deduplication, compression, and erasure coding. They are intelligent & adaptive, and in most cases, require little or no fine-tuning. In fact, two levels of post-process compression are enabled in conjunction with cold data classification by default on new shipping clusters. Because they’re entirely software driven, it also means existing customers can take advantage of new capabilities and enhancements by upgrading AOS. I have recently upgraded my vCenter from 6.0 -> 6.5u1, and I'm not looking to upgrade my ESXi 6.0u3 installs to 6.5u1. My first attempt was to use one-click hypervisor upgrade, and I was able to uploading the ISO and MD5 checksum, but the pre-upgrade check errors out pretty quickly with a fairly generic error message saying "unable to determine version of bundle." Did a few re-download and re-upload attempts to verify my file integrity but the error persisted. I then tried to do the upgrade old-school style using VUM which is conveniently baked into my VCSA as of 6.5, and I got another generic error message inside of update manager, "The upgrade contains the following set of conflicting VIBs:" with nothing but blank space following the colon. Typically I would have expected to see an individual VIB called out in list form, but there is just nothing there. I am fully patched to current using Nutanix LCM, so I suspect it is probably one of the LSI HBA updates that LCM has slipped in
